Idea Hub: A core team whose specific job is to ensure that the best content ideas in the Television space are with us, whether emerging intrinsically, or being evolved externally. This involves a multi-pronged approach which will involve:&lt;br /&gt;-          Clearly defining what the Channel content objectives are, assessing specifically which TAG is the epicenter of our programming, and additionally, if we want to target any niche segments through special interest programming.&lt;br /&gt;-          Redefining Assessment metrics for evaluation of any submitted ideas/pilots by outside agencies, keeping in mind our Channel Content Objectives.&lt;br /&gt;-          Developing in house capability for creating novel themes/formats for both fiction and nonfiction genres, as complete reliance on outside agencies for content ideas is not the best strategy. Also, be open to joining hands with unconventional sources for content creation.&lt;br /&gt;-          Initiating Strategic Partnerships with the best creative/media schools in the country, like MICA, FTII through case study competitions, white papers, internships etc. to leverage the new ideas that emerge from these sources. Initiate → sustain → drive → leverage this partnership.&lt;br /&gt;-          Make content innovation open source, but defining who the participants can be. This can be an online platform, where we selectively offer memberships to qualified professionals from across the globe to participate in the content ideation process. Keeping this separate at all times from the actual programming strategies being followed internally.&lt;br /&gt;-          R&amp;amp;D to create new sources for content, commissioned content etc.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;2. Competition analysis: In a highly dynamic &amp;amp; competitive space like television, it is critical to have a clear assessment of all actions of the key competitors, and what the source of their competitive advantage is. The following questions may help towards defining how we should effectively counter competitive moves of another GEC:&lt;br /&gt;-          What are the key drivers for their growth?  -  Example: Big Budget reality shows in case of Colors, as a launch strategy.&lt;br /&gt;-          Is their growth a direct result of our weaknesses, or are they really doing something different?&lt;br /&gt;-          Is our content a reflection of the changing social/cultural mindsets of the audience? Are we as progressive as the audience that we want to talk to?&lt;br /&gt;-          Is their competitive advantage sustainable? If yes, how can we counter and neutralize it?&lt;br /&gt;-          How can we create sustainable competitive advantage for our channel, which others cannot imitate? – A thought: create in-house formats for innovative shows, which legally cannot be imitated by others, be the first mover in locking &amp;amp; securing the best content ideas before others reach them.&lt;br /&gt;-          How do we come up with new/game changing strategies? – A thought: Star Player is a great initiative, as integrated media is finding increasing resonance with the audiences, but how do we monetize it? And how do we leverage it to make it a competitive advantage?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;3.  Programming: I am not a proponent of the current system of Lowest Common Denominator Programming, and of trying to create a mass appeal using stereotypical genres. I strongly believe that though an in depth understanding of the Targeted Audience group’s tastes and preferences is the key to successful content, trying to create content by second guessing their preferences is not. Audiences like to be pleasantly surprised, and would certainly enjoy content that is fresh, in previously unseen or uncommon genres, and with an unusual perspective on usual things. Some thoughts on this:&lt;br /&gt;-          Once we clear the short listing phase for content ideas, we should do a storyboard/concept test with focus groups/sample groups and gauge their reactions. Also, a mechanism has to be formulated where the final content decision is based on multiple key attributes with assigned weights, such as our programming needs, competitive landscape, attraction for advertisers, and most importantly, resonance with the TAG.&lt;br /&gt;-          Even the best conceptual idea is after all, a concept. The key lies in how well we can execute this on screen, and how well it will come across to the audience. More diligence is required here, for a lot of brilliant ideas lose their punch between the storyboard and the screen.&lt;br /&gt;-          Yuppies - Young, Urban, Upwardly Mobile Professionals &amp;amp; DINKS - Double income no kids: Where is the content for these guys? These educated professionals, residing in urban India, are finding less and less resonance with TV, and are difficult to ignore for a programmer because they are target consumer groups for a lot of advertisers, and thus  an important segment for us as a prime advertising medium to cater to.
